Football Recap: Catholic of Pointe Coupee Hornets vs. Ouachita Christian Eagles
Catholic of Pointe Coupee and Ouachita Christian squared off in some playoff action on Friday, but Catholic of Pointe Coupee had to settle for second. They lost 28-6 to the Ouachita Christian Eagles. The Hornets have been going strong on the season, but this is now their second defeat in a row.
Catholic of Pointe Coupee didn't go easy on the quarterback and picked off two passes before the game was over. The picks came courtesy of Parker Jewell and Kooper Burke.
Ouachita Christian's win was a true team effort,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Makin Lenard, who rushed for 72 yards and two touchdowns.
Catholic of Pointe Coupee's loss dropped their record down to 9-2. As for Ouachita Christian,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 11-1.
Catholic of Pointe Coupee does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Ouachita Christian, they also wasted no time getting back out on the field and have already played their next match, a 30-14 win against Covenant Christian Academy on the 29th.
